Output 04d52de094addc31b8af75a9049716887e767bf12d0033ff361def6ce841cd5a:63

value
39981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2ed5de5dafe4c4dc2dbd1843b68647bc2ccaa4 OP_EQUAL
address
3HJ9aXe6QRdyF5tzWU5Z4jVmyV6k9uNaFF
transaction
04d52de094addc31b8af75a9049716887e767bf12d0033ff361def6ce841cd5a
spent
true